Everything you need to know about Infrastructure-as-a-Service (IaaS) - 0 views

  •  
    Infrastructure as a Service (IaaS) is a service model of cloud computing, alongside Platform as a Service (PaaS) and Software as a Service (SaaS). It allows businesses to rent cloud infrastructure on a pay-as-you-go service.

3 possible futures facing telecoms by 2025 - 1 views

  •  
    The telecoms sector is undergoing a series of fundamental transitions, including challenges such as OTT and new revenue streams such as the IoT and M2M market. In particular, there is a battle to be fought between telecoms and internet companies over how much of the value chain they will control.
